什么是安省 First Aid 培训?

安省 First Aid 培训,即安大略省的急救培训,是一项旨在教授个人基本急救技能和知识的课程。这些技能包括但不限于心肺复苏术(CPR)、自动体外除颤器(AED)的使用、处理窒息、伤口护理以及应对突发健康事件如心脏病发作或中风的基本方法。该培训通常由认证机构提供,如VICedu等,并符合加拿大红十字会或圣约翰救护机构的标准。

在技术领域,掌握急救技能尤为重要,因为工作环境可能涉及到潜在的工作场所危险。参加安省 First Aid 培训不仅可以提高员工的安全意识,还能在紧急情况发生时提供及时的帮助,减少事故的严重性。通常,课程包括理论学习和实践演练,确保参与者能够有效地应用所学知识。对于技术人员来说,这些技能能够在实验室、工厂或其他技术环境中发挥关键作用,保护自己和同事的安全。

安省 First Aid 培训可以学到什么

安省 First Aid 培训是一项全面的课程,旨在教授学员如何在紧急情况下提供有效的初步急救措施。该课程通常涵盖多个关键主题,包括心肺复苏术(CPR)、自动体外除颤器(AED)的使用、创伤护理、出血控制、骨折固定以及呼吸道阻塞的处理等。

学员还将学习如何辨识和应对常见的医疗紧急情况,如心脏病发作、中风、过敏反应和休克等。课程内容通常结合理论与实践,通过实际操作演练和案例分析帮助学员掌握必要的技能。此外,学员还会学习到有关急救法律责任和伦理的基本知识,以及如何在各种环境中进行风险评估和安全现场管理。

安省 First Aid 培训需要准备什么

在参加安省的 First Aid 培训之前,学习者需要做好充分的准备以确保培训过程顺利且高效。首先,了解培训课程的具体内容和结构是非常重要的。大多数 First Aid 培训课程,包括标准急救和 CPR/AED 级别 C,通常涵盖紧急情况评估、心肺复苏术、AED 的使用、创伤处理以及其他常见急救技术。详细了解这些内容有助于预先思考和准备。

其次,学员需要准备合适的服装和个人装备。由于培训可能包括实际操作和模拟练习,舒适的运动服和便于活动的鞋子是理想选择。此外,携带笔记本和笔以便记录关键要点和个人笔记也是很有帮助的。

此外,确保携带有效的身份证明文件和课程注册信息,以便在培训当天顺利办理注册手续。对于参加在线课程的学员,确保有稳定的网络连接和合适的设备来访问虚拟课堂也是必要的。

最后,提前了解培训地点的交通情况以及住宿安排(如适用)可以帮助学员更好地规划时间。通过充分的准备,学员能够在安省的 First Aid 培训中获得最大收益,掌握急救技能以备不时之需。

Course content (selected):
• First aid fundamentals and response steps
• Handling emergencies (choking, heart attack/angina, shock, stroke, allergic reactions, asthma, burns/scalds, etc.)
• CPR (cardiopulmonary resuscitation)
• AED use
Format & certification:
• Duration: ~5 hours online + ~5 hours in‑class practice
• Certificate: Standard First Aid & CPR Level C, valid for 3 years
